I'm trying to get pylint running on windows and the bat file for it
seems a little screwy. I'm hoping someone may have figured this out
already.

rem = """-*-Python-*- script
@echo off
rem -------------------- DOS section --------------------
rem You could set PYTHONPATH or TK environment variables here
python %*
goto exit
 
"""
# -------------------- Python section --------------------
import sys
from logilab.pylint import lint
lint.Run(sys.argv[1:])
 

DosExitLabel = """
:exit
rem """

All I get is the python prompt, the lines starting at import sys don't
run.  If I throw the lines in a python script, I run into path issues.

The overall effect I'm trying to achieve is....

c:\Projects\myproject\pylint mymodule.py



Any ideas?
